网络数据库用什么格式

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    网络数据库通常使用的格式有以下几种:

    1. 结构化查询语言(SQL):SQL是一种用于管理关系型数据库的标准化语言。它可以用于创建、修改和查询数据库中的表、索引和视图等对象。SQL是一种易于学习和使用的语言,广泛应用于各种数据库管理系统(DBMS)。

    2. NoSQL:NoSQL(Not Only SQL)是一种非关系型数据库的概念,它使用不同于传统关系型数据库的数据存储模型。NoSQL数据库可以使用各种格式存储数据,如文档型、键值型、列型和图形型等。这些数据库通常适用于大规模的分布式系统和处理非结构化数据的场景。

    3. XML:XML(可扩展标记语言)是一种用于存储和传输结构化数据的标记语言。它使用自定义标签来描述数据的结构和内容,具有良好的可读性和可扩展性。XML广泛应用于Web服务、配置文件和数据交换等领域。

    4. JSON:JSON(JavaScript对象表示法)是一种轻量级的数据交换格式。它采用键值对的形式来表示数据,易于理解和解析。JSON常用于Web应用程序之间的数据传输和存储。

    5. CSV:CSV(逗号分隔值)是一种简单的文本格式,用于存储表格数据。每行表示一条记录,字段之间使用逗号进行分隔。CSV文件可以被广泛支持的应用程序(如电子表格软件)读取和处理。

    总结起来,网络数据库可以使用SQL、NoSQL、XML、JSON和CSV等不同的格式来存储和管理数据。选择适合的格式取决于具体的应用场景和需求。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    网络数据库使用的格式主要有两种:关系型数据库和非关系型数据库。

    1. 关系型数据库(RDBMS):
      关系型数据库是最常用的数据库类型,采用表格的形式来存储数据,并通过行和列的关系来建立数据之间的联系。其中最常见的关系型数据库是MySQL、Oracle、SQL Server等。关系型数据库具有以下特点:
    • 数据结构化:数据以表格的形式进行组织和存储,每个表格由多个行和列组成。
    • 数据一致性:关系型数据库使用事务来保证数据的一致性,即要么全部操作成功,要么全部失败。
    • SQL查询:关系型数据库使用结构化查询语言(SQL)进行数据查询和操作。
    • 数据完整性:关系型数据库支持定义数据的完整性约束,如主键、外键等。
    1. 非关系型数据库(NoSQL):
      非关系型数据库是近年来兴起的一种新型数据库,也被称为NoSQL数据库。与关系型数据库不同,非关系型数据库不使用表格的形式来存储数据,而是采用其他数据结构,如键值对、文档、列族、图等。最常见的非关系型数据库有MongoDB、Redis、Cassandra等。非关系型数据库具有以下特点:
    • 数据非结构化:数据以键值对、文档等非结构化形式进行存储,不需要预先定义表结构。
    • 高扩展性:非关系型数据库具有良好的横向扩展性,可以方便地增加更多的节点来处理大规模数据。
    • 高性能:非关系型数据库通常使用内存或者磁盘存储数据,以提供快速的读写能力。
    • 灵活性:非关系型数据库不需要事务支持,可以灵活地处理大量数据的读写操作。

    总之,关系型数据库适用于需要严格数据结构和一致性的应用场景,而非关系型数据库适用于需要高扩展性和高性能的大规模数据应用场景。选择何种格式取决于具体的应用需求和数据特点。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    网络数据库可以使用多种格式来存储数据,常见的格式有以下几种:

    1. 结构化数据格式:结构化数据是指具有固定格式和结构的数据,最常见的结构化数据格式是关系型数据库(如MySQL、Oracle、SQL Server等)。关系型数据库使用表格的形式来组织数据,每个表格包含多个列和行,每行表示一个记录,每列表示一个属性。关系型数据库具有良好的数据一致性和数据完整性,支持SQL语言进行数据查询和操作。

    2. 非结构化数据格式:非结构化数据是指没有固定格式和结构的数据,例如文本文件、图像、音频、视频等。非结构化数据通常以文件的形式存储,可以使用文件系统来管理和存储这些数据。非结构化数据的存储和处理相对较为复杂,需要采用特定的技术和工具进行处理。

    3. 半结构化数据格式:半结构化数据是指介于结构化数据和非结构化数据之间的数据,它具有一定的结构,但不符合严格的表格形式。常见的半结构化数据格式包括XML(可扩展标记语言)和JSON(JavaScript对象表示法)。XML使用标签来描述数据的结构和属性,JSON使用键值对的形式来表示数据。半结构化数据具有较好的灵活性和扩展性,适用于存储和交换复杂的数据结构。

    4. 对象数据格式:对象数据格式是指将数据以对象的形式进行存储和管理的格式。对象数据格式通常用于面向对象的数据库系统,例如MongoDB。对象数据库将数据存储为对象的集合,每个对象都有自己的属性和方法。对象数据库支持面向对象的数据建模和查询语言,适用于存储和处理复杂的对象结构。

    在实际应用中,根据不同的需求和场景,可以选择合适的数据格式来存储和管理网络数据库中的数据。结构化数据格式适用于需要严格的数据一致性和完整性的场景,非结构化数据格式适用于存储大量的非结构化数据,半结构化数据格式适用于具有一定结构的数据,对象数据格式适用于面向对象的数据建模和查询。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部